How much is 80k after taxes in GA?
If you make $80,000 a year living in the region of Georgia, USA, you will be taxed $20,871. That means that your net pay will be $59,130 per year, or $4,927 per month. Your average tax rate is 26.1% and your marginal tax rate is 35.4%.
What income is considered middle class in Atlanta GA?
In Atlanta, for example, middle class income is defined as between $48,000 and $141,000.

What is considered middle class in Georgia?
Georgia’s household income range for the middle class is $23,948 – $114,234. The state’s median family income is the 18th lowest in the country at $74,833. The Peach States has the 7th lowest middle-class share of income in the nation at 45.4%.

How much is 100k after taxes in Georgia?
If you make $100,000 a year living in the region of Georgia, USA, you will be taxed $27,685. That means that your net pay will be $72,315 per year, or $6,026 per month. Your average tax rate is 27.7% and your marginal tax rate is 37.0%.
How much is 60000 a year after taxes in Georgia?
If you make $60,000 a year living in the region of Georgia, USA, you will be taxed $13,525. That means that your net pay will be $46,475 per year, or $3,873 per month. Your average tax rate is 22.5% and your marginal tax rate is 35.4%.
How much is 70k after taxes in Georgia?
If you make $70,000 a year living in the region of Georgia, USA, you will be taxed $17,065. That means that your net pay will be $52,935 per year, or $4,411 per month. Your average tax rate is 24.4% and your marginal tax rate is 35.4%.
